A used Jeep Grand Cherokee engine (116.7" WB (VIN G, H or Y, 6th digit), VIN H (6th digit, 4x4), 5.7L (VIN T, 8th digit, gasoline)) costs $2,299 to $6,644, with a median asking price of $3,900. Based on 71 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 12,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

This pricing covers the 116.7" WB (VIN G, H or Y, 6th digit), VIN H (6th digit, 4x4), 5.7L (VIN T, 8th digit, gasoline) variant of the Jeep Grand Cherokee engine, based on 71 priced listings across 2 model years (2023, 2024). Its $3,900 median is 5% above the Jeep Grand Cherokee engine overall median of $3,729.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
